Annual Veterans Day Town Tree Tour in Pittsboro

Veterans Day is a time to thank our veterans.  Grand Trees of Chatham recently evaluated a Southern Sugar Maple in Pittsboro that looks like it will qualify as a county champion.  We will be visiting this and other fascinating elder trees around town.

This all-ages tree walk begins at Pittsboro Toys on the courthouse circle, 15 Hillsboro St., at 11 AM on Friday November 11th.  Dress for the weather and be prepared to cross several streets while walking about town for about 1 hour.  Suitable for strollers, both wheeled and bipedal.  Bring your questions!

We celebrate Chatham County Arbor Month in November because this is the best time to plant trees here.
